Established wet gas metering techniques are typically based on differentialpressure devices, and their measurement accuracy is still unsatisfactory tonatural gas industry. Coriolis mass flowmeter (CMF) is the most superior flowmeasurement technology at now, it can provide mass flowrate and density outputsimultaneously. Putting CMF into wet gas metering may be a reasonable and highaccuracy solution to natural gas industry demands. The problems and advantagesof CMF in gas-liquid two-phase flow metering has been analyzed, a seriousexperiments has been carried out to test the possibility and feasibility of CMFas wet gas meter. Experimental conclusions are promising,CMF can work properlyin wet gas metering condition, and the repeatability test of CMF is perfect, andthe relationship between the true mass flowrate and CMF readings are almostlinear.
